On Tue, Mar 09, 2010 at 09:47:38PM +0100, Thomas Treutner wrote:
> Hi,
>
> I'm referring to this patchset
>
> http://www.mail-archive.com/kvm@vger.kernel.org/msg23810.html
>
> of Marcelo Tosatti. It seems it was never included or even discussed, although
> it's nearly half a year old. I wonder if there is a good reason for that? I'd
> like to use the steal time for my VMs, as I consider it useful in some cases.
There is a problem with it: stolen time is accounted separately (in
addition to) user/system/idle.
And as you noted there seems to be lack of interest in the feature.
